[PATCH rs6000] Fix for commit 249311

2017-06-16 Thread Carl Love
GCC maintainers:

Commit r249311 had an error.  During the patch review the define expand
for VFC_inst was changed to VF_sxddp.  I compiled and tested the source
after making the change and it seemed fine.  However, I missed a couple
of changes.  It seems that since I didn't remove all the binaries before
recompiling the build tree still had the old definition in it. I also
found I had to move the VF_sxddp definition back to the file where it is
used.  Need to make sure I do a clean build just to be sure before
committing things.

I found the issue after pulling down a fresh tree and compiling when the
build failed.  I have already applied the following change to the tree
as I didn't want to leave a broken tree all weekend. Please let me know
if there are any changes to this fix-up patch that you would like to see
made and I will take care of it. 

Sorry about breaking things.

  Carl Love


gcc/ChangeLog:

2017-06-16  Carl Love  

* config/rs6000/altivec.md (define_mode_attr VF_sxddp): Move to vsx.md.
* config/rs6000/vsx.md (define_mode_attr VF_sxddp
define_expand "floate",
define_expand "floato"): Add VF_sxddp definition, replace
undefined VFC_inst with VF_sxddp definition
